A massive fire has broken out at the Kenyatta family-owned land along the Eastern Bypass in Ruiru, Kiambu county.
The incident occurred shortly after a group of unidentified individuals stormed the Northlands farm, vandalizing property of unknown value.
A multitude of Kenyans on Monday, March 27 reportedly invaded the expansive farm associated with the family of former President Uhuru Kenyatta.
The group gained access to the land from the Kamakis side via the busy bypass and were seen stealing sheep from the property.
Some of the people could be seen breaching the fence and carrying livestock. It was not immediately clear what the motive behind the activity is and the Kenyatta family is yet to issue a statement on the reports.
The affected property includes Brookside Dairy and Peponi School, which are situated inside the vast property that stretches for acres.
The reason behind the attack is yet to be determined. The fire department is currently at the scene trying to contain the inferno, which has caused widespread panic among locals.
